Senator Lewis Voices Disappointment over Rail Merger Approval

Senator Lewis Voices Disappointment over Rail Merger Approval

On Wednesday, March 15, federal regulators approved a $31 billion acquisition of Kansas City Southern Railroad by Canadian Pacific. It was the first major railroad merger in more than 20 years, and it will have a direct impact on several suburban Chicago communities. Senator Lewis Applauds Illinois’ Rankings in Site Selection Magazine Annual Study

Seth-Lewis-House-Floor

In its recent rankings of state-by-state corporate expansion and relocation projects, Site Selection Magazine has announced the State of Illinois had the second most qualified capital investment projects in the nation in 2022, and the fourth most projects per capita. Senator Seth Lewis Responds to Gov. Pritzker’s Budget Address

Senator Seth Lewis Responds to Gov. Pritzker’s Budget Address

On February 15, Governor JB Pritzker presented his combined State of the State and Budget Address before a joint session of the Illinois Senate and House.
